"Tip of the Month -SEALS
This month’s tip is for you guys doing your own rebuilds. I get asked all the time where can I get seals for my engine. If you don’t want to use seals that have been sitting around in the bottom of a box for 30-40 years here’s where I have been getting mine. If what you need is not listed here if you take a crank and block with you they can measure what you need and set you up. I have used these seals for both Gas and Alky without any problems.
I get my seals at NAPA! Now how easy is that? They carry Chicago Rawhide seals and can get them in a day. This is the number on the box and if what you need here is not listed this will get you into the right family of seals. It’s a lot easier than telling some parts guy that you need a seal for 12,000 RPM with Alky fuel. It saves both you and him a lot of head scratching.
#9243 ¾” PTO seals for both 100 and 125cc Mac’s.
#6816 is the PTO seal for 92,93 & 101 engines.
#7421 is the 101 dust shield.
#7414 is the seal for the inner mag side of 91,92,93 & 101 engines"
